BitFire Networks Supports NFL Radio Broadcasts

For the entire 2021-2022 NFL Football Season, BitFire’s technology will bring all the excitement of the NFL to radio airwaves across the country. BitFire’s new partnership with Adhara Communications will provide broadcasting support for every game during the season. For most games, BitFire’s systems will connect multiple broadcasts from each NFL stadium with home, away and national calls all happening simultaneously.

Sports and technology firm Adhara Communications coordinated the massive install of a private and secure fiber MPLS network at all 30 NFL venues. Adhara then deployed their Line Out Connectivity Services (LOCS), which marries Adhara’s MPLS with BitFire’s services and proprietary technology. BitFire is contracted to power and serve LOCS.

“Redundant internet connections are not unique,” says Bob Sullivan, President and CEO of BitFire Networks. “However, our system allows it to be supported with just one BitFire server onsite. Both connections use the BitFire Transport Network, providing support, monitoring, reliability and security.”

Adhara’s clients consist of 30 of the 32 NFL teams and the four national radio broadcast networks, Westwood One, Compass, ESPN and Sports USA. All will be utilizing BitFire’s proprietary technology and support from their 24/7 Network Operations Center.
